> Bug description:
> Once a window is opened it is very difficult to close or minimise it because 
> the relevant buttons have been overwritten by the window title text. On 
> pressing the <Alt> key the buttons re-appear.
> This issue is present in both the Radiance theme and the Ambiance theme. I 
> have not tried others.
